titleOfInvention TOOTH BLEACHERS
abstract 1. A tooth whitening agent containing composition (A) and composition (B) in separate formulations and which should be used by alternately applying composition (A) and composition (B) to the teeth, where: composition (A) contains 0.1 wt.% or more and 30 wt.% or less phytic acid or its salt, calculated as acid, does not contain any polyvalent metal cations or, alternatively, contains such cations in an amount of less than 0.1 mol of the phytic acid content or its salt, has a pH value at 25 ° C of 4 or more and 6.5 or less , and contains fluoride in such an amount that the mass ratio of fluoride in terms of fluorine atoms to phytic acid in terms of acid (fluoride in terms of fluorine atoms / phytic acid) is 0.05 or less or, as an alternative, does not contain fluorides; composition (B) contains one or more components selected from orthophosphoric acid, condensed phosphoric acid and their salts, in an amount of 0.01 wt.% or more and 15 wt.% or less in terms of acid, and has a pH value of 25 ° C more than 6.5 and 10.5 or less. 2. A tooth whitening agent according to claim 1, wherein the fluoride included in the composition (A) is one or more compounds selected from sodium fluoride, potassium fluoride, ammonium fluoride, tin (II) fluoride and sodium monofluorophosphate. 3. A tooth whitening agent according to claim 1 or 2, wherein composition (B) is applied to teeth first and then composition (A) is applied to teeth. 4. A tooth whitening agent according to claim 1 or 2, wherein composition (B) further includes fluoride and composition (B) is applied to the teeth after applying composition (A) to the teeth. 5.
